Night Shift Supervisor - Manufacturing

Due to YOY consistent growth, regular investment into new equipment & acquisitions in their market; my Client have now introduced a night shift (1900 - 0700) to their Wirral based site, & I am looking to speak with Candidates who can demonstrate relevant experience, & a strong desire to succeed & deliver at the highest of standards on the night shift.

What will you be responsible for as Night Shift Supervisor:

You will actively supervise all activities within both manual & automated production areas, thus ensuring targets relating to Production, Quality, Health and Safety, are met & exceeded where possible - encouraging the enhancement rates for the Machine Operatives where possible.

How will your success be measured:

Production

  • Supervision & direction of the Production Team ensuring maximum output, whilst maintaining health, safety & quality always.
  • Allocation of strongest resources are in place to ensure daily/weekly production targets are achieved.
  • Management of down time of production equipment and ensure procedures relating to down time are adhered to, including operator care programmes.
  • Implementation of periodic checks throughout the shift to ensure targets are being achieved where possible.
  • Check & maintain material availability prior to production runs starting to ensure planned quantities are achieved.

Quality

  • Ensure all production employees adhere to company Quality procedures and processes, enforcing the discipline that all quality failures are repaired by the originator.
  • Implement periodic quality inspections to ensure customer expectations are being achieved, and that the product output levels meet internal specification/ tolerance levels.

HSE

  • Ensure all production employees adhere to company H&S procedures with regard to PPE, accident/incident reporting etc.
  • Assist in the induction process and training of all new production employees, ensuring that a safe system of work is maintained at all time.
  • Ensuring that all training records are maintained and updated & any training requirements are identified at the earliest opportunity.

General

  • Ensure finished goods and timber storage areas are kept in an orderly fashion to ensure stock can be counted without personal risk.
  • Implement Housekeeping initiatives to ensure production areas are kept in tidy and orderly, including the management & reduction of waste/scrap bins.
  • Manage timekeeping, attendance to ensure weekly KPI's are not affected.
  • Management of overtime to ensure site targets are achieved.
  • Cover for other members of the team as and when required
